Tuesday 16 October 2007

Walsall Manor Hospital 
Our third job within Walsall Manor involved supplying and installing a trace heating system to maintain 55m of DHWS pipework at +55°C in an ambient of +18°C.

Wednesday 3 October 2007

Walsall Manor Hospital 
For this project ESH supplied materials and labour to install and commission the trace heating system to maintain the DHWS pipework at +55°C, together with a temperature controller to purge the system once a week a +65°C. This project required 400m of type H2OWAT65 self limiting heating tape.
